Technical Specifications
1:1 accurate mixing ratio; 3-minute vacuum defoaming. Fast 20-minute heating curing at 80-100℃, 3-8 hours room-temperature curing. Full-size packaging options, 1-year sealed shelf life, acid and alkali resistant storage.

How to use
1. Uniformly stir A and B components before mixing.
2. Mix materials at standard 1:1 weight ratio.
3. Defoam sufficiently then pour into target workpieces.
4. Adopt heating curing for enhanced temperature resistance.
